"Donkey Kong 64" is a classic video game released for the Nintendo 64 in 1999. The game's soundtrack, composed by Grant Kirkhope, is well-regarded for its catchy and memorable tunes. Here are some interesting facts about the "Donkey Kong 64" OST:

  1. Evolving Themes: The game features character-specific themes that evolve as players progress. Each Kong has its own instrument added to the main theme as they are unlocked, creating a dynamic and evolving soundtrack.

  2. Hideout Helm: The final level of the game, Hideout Helm, features a unique approach to its music. The theme is composed of several layers that can be dynamically muted or activated based on the player's progress in the level. This interactive music design was innovative for its time.

  3. Rareware Roots: Grant Kirkhope, the composer, was part of Rareware, the company responsible for "Donkey Kong 64." He also composed music for other Rare titles like "Banjo-Kazooie" and "GoldenEye 007." His work on these games contributed to the distinctive and beloved sound of Rareware titles in the late '90s.

  4. Diddy's Guitar: Diddy Kong's theme prominently features an electric guitar, reflecting his cool and adventurous personality. The guitar riff has become iconic and is often associated with the character.

  5. "DK Rap": The game's introduction features a rap song known as the "DK Rap," which introduces the main characters in the game. While it has become somewhat infamous for its cheesy lyrics, it has also gained a cult following and is remembered by fans for its nostalgic value.

  6. Remixes and Arrangements: The "Donkey Kong 64" soundtrack has been subject to numerous remixes and arrangements by fans over the years. Many musicians in the gaming community have reinterpreted the themes, showcasing the enduring popularity of the game's music.

  7. Musical Variety: The soundtrack covers a wide range of musical styles, from upbeat and adventurous tunes to atmospheric and moody tracks. This diversity helps create a rich and immersive experience as players explore different levels and environments.

  8. Emotional Impact: Certain tracks, such as "Crystal Caves" and "Fungi Forest," are noted for their emotional impact. The music enhances the atmosphere of the game and contributes to the player's connection with the characters and the world.

The "Donkey Kong 64" OST remains a cherished part of many gamers' nostalgic memories, and its catchy tunes continue to be celebrated in the gaming community.
